Grow Tower - Strategic Tower Building Puzzle Game

Seele01-Flash
By
Grow Tower is a captivating strategic puzzle game where you build towering structures by carefully placing objects in the correct sequence. Each placement decision affects how your tower evolves and grows.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"**Grow Tower 3D Reimagined**".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style**: Low-poly 3D art with **Toon Shading (Cel-shading)** to mimic the original flat, colorful Flash aesthetic. Use a bright, saturated color palette (Sky Blue background color `#4CC9E6`). * **Camera Setup**: Use an **Orthographic Camera** positioned at a slight isometric angle to give a "diorama" or "toy set" feel. The camera should automatically pan up as the tower grows. * **Core Models**: * **The Base**: A robotic/mechanical brick foundation. * **Selectable Objects**: 5 distinct 3D icons representing the game elements: Brick (Red), Pot (Brown), Sphere (Yellow), Battery/Energy (Grey), and Face/Creature (White). * **Evolution Models**: Each object needs 3 states of growth (Level 1: Basic Block, Level 2: Expanded/Decorated, Level 3: Max Evolution). * *Example*: The "Pot" starts as a small planter, grows a tree, and finally becomes a floating island with a waterfall. * **Environment**: Floating stylized low-poly clouds that drift slowly in the background. A ruler/height marker on the left side of the screen using 3D text. * **Effects**: Particle explosions (confetti or stars) when an object levels up. A "shake" effect on the tower when a new piece is added. ### 2. Audio Requirements * **BGM**: A whimsical, looping track featuring pizzicato strings, woodwinds, and light percussion. It should feel curious and upbeat (tempo ~100 BPM). * **Sound Effects (SFX)**: * **Select**: A soft "pop" or "bubble" sound. * **Placement**: A mechanical "clunk" or building construction noise. * **Evolution**: A rising harp glissando or chime sound indicating a Level Up. * **Win**: A short fanfare trumpet burst. * **Reset**: A rewind or "woosh" sound. ### 3. Gameplay Loop * **Core Mechanic**: A sequence-based logic puzzle. The player starts with 5 buttons. * **Turn Logic**: 1. Player taps an unused button. 2. The object appears on the tower (or modifies the tower). 3. **The "Grow" Phase**: The game checks interactions. For example, if "Sun" is placed *after* "Pot", the Pot levels up. If placed *before*, the Pot stays small. 4. All objects currently on the screen attempt to "evolve" based on the new addition. * **Goal**: Find the correct permutation (sequence order) of the 5 items that results in **all objects reaching Level MAX**. * **Win Condition**: When the final item is placed, if total tower height (sum of levels) equals the maximum possible score, trigger the Win Animation (rainbows, chest opening). * **Reset**: A "Reset" button must be available at all times to clear the scene and restart the sequence. ### 4. Mobile Controls & Interaction * **Screen Orientation**: **Portrait Mode** (Vertical) is mandatory to accommodate the tall tower structure. * **UI Layout**: * **Action Bar**: Place the 5 selectable object buttons in a horizontal row at the **bottom of the screen** (Thumb zone). Buttons should be large (min 60x60px) with high contrast. * **Status**: A "Reset" button in the top-right corner. * **Touch Interactions**: * **Tap**: Select item to place. * **Haptic Feedback**: Trigger a short vibration (using `navigator.vibrate`) when an item is placed or levels up. * **Drag/Swipe**: Allow the player to vertically scroll/pan the camera if the tower grows taller than the screen. * **Responsiveness**: Ensure the canvas resizes correctly on window resize and looks sharp on high-DPI (Retina) mobile screens.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Grow Tower is an innovative strategic puzzle game that challenges players to construct the ultimate tower through careful planning and strategic thinking. This engaging title combines tower building mechanics with puzzle-solving elements, creating a unique gaming experience where every decision matters. The game's simple yet deep mechanics make it accessible to casual players while offering enough strategic depth to challenge puzzle enthusiasts.

Core Features

Strategic Object Placement System

The heart of Grow Tower lies in its revolutionary placement mechanics. Players must strategically position 5 different objects (plus 1 hidden object) to create the tallest possible tower. Each object evolves and transforms based on its placement order and interactions with other elements, making every playthrough a unique puzzle-solving experience.

Dynamic Evolution Mechanics

What sets Grow Tower apart is its dynamic evolution system. Objects don't simply stack – they transform, interact, and evolve based on their positioning and the order in which they're placed. This creates countless possibilities and encourages experimentation to discover the optimal building sequence.

Engaging Visual Design

The game features charming cartoon-style graphics with delightful animations that bring your tower to life. Colorful objects, smooth transitions, and satisfying visual feedback make each building attempt enjoyable to watch unfold.

Hidden Secrets and Discoveries

Beyond the standard 5 objects, Grow Tower includes hidden elements that can be unlocked through clever experimentation. These secret objects add an extra layer of depth and replayability to the puzzle-solving experience.

Gameplay Mechanics

Tower Construction Process

Building your tower is both simple and complex. Using intuitive mouse controls, you select from available objects and place them on your growing structure. However, the challenge lies in determining the optimal sequence – the order matters significantly in how your tower develops.

Level Progression System

Each object can level up and evolve through multiple stages. Higher levels unlock new visual designs and enhanced capabilities, but achieving maximum levels requires careful planning of the entire tower sequence. The goal is to maximize the level of each component while creating the tallest possible structure.

Strategic Planning Requirements

Success in Grow Tower demands forward thinking. Players must consider how each object will interact with previously placed items and how future additions might affect the overall structure. This creates a satisfying puzzle experience that rewards both logical thinking and creative experimentation.

Operation Guide

Basic Controls

  • Left Mouse Button : Select and place objects from the available inventory
  • Click and Drag : Position objects precisely on your growing tower
  • Menu Navigation : Use mouse to access game options and restart functions

Building Strategy Tips

  1. Experiment with Order : Try different placement sequences to discover optimal combinations
  2. Observe Interactions : Watch how objects affect each other when placed in proximity
  3. Plan Ahead : Consider the entire tower structure before making placement decisions
  4. Seek Hidden Elements : Experiment with unusual combinations to unlock secret objects

Why Play Grow Tower

Perfect for Puzzle Enthusiasts

Grow Tower offers the ideal blend of accessibility and depth. New players can jump in immediately with simple mouse controls, while experienced puzzle solvers will appreciate the strategic complexity and multiple solution paths.

Stress-Free Gaming Experience

With no time pressure or failure penalties, Grow Tower provides a relaxing yet engaging gaming experience. Players can experiment freely, restart at any time, and enjoy the process of discovery without frustration.

Highly Replayable Content

The multiple object combinations and evolution paths ensure that Grow Tower remains engaging across multiple playthroughs. Each attempt to reach the maximum tower height feels fresh and challenging.

Instant Browser Access

As a free browser-based game, Grow Tower requires no downloads or installations. Simply open your web browser and start building immediately, making it perfect for quick gaming sessions or extended puzzle-solving marathons.

Frequently Asked Questions (FAQ)